From mboxrd@z Thu Jan 1 00:00:00 1970 From: Karl Hiramoto Subject: [RFC 2/4] nf_conntrack_queue: define struct that will be stored in nf_ct_extend Date: Sat, 24 Jul 2010 17:44:43 +0200 Message-ID: <1279986285-11665-3-git-send-email-karl@hiramoto.org> References: <1279986285-11665-1-git-send-email-karl@hiramoto.org> Cc: Karl Hiramoto To: netfilter-devel@vger.kernel.org Return-path: Received: from hapkido.dreamhost.com ([66.33.216.122]:60989 "EHLO hapkido.dreamhost.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752502Ab0GXPqV (ORCPT ); Sat, 24 Jul 2010 11:46:21 -0400 Received: from homiemail-a30.g.dreamhost.com (caiajhbdccah.dreamhost.com [208.97.132.207]) by hapkido.dreamhost.com (Postfix) with ESMTP id 2FA5B17C78B for ; Sat, 24 Jul 2010 08:46:19 -0700 (PDT) In-Reply-To: <1279986285-11665-1-git-send-email-karl@hiramoto.org> Sender: netfilter-devel-owner@vger.kernel.org List-ID: Signed-off-by: Karl Hiramoto --- include/net/netfilter/nf_conntrack_queue.h | 17 +++++++++++++++++ 1 files changed, 17 insertions(+), 0 deletions(-) create mode 100644 include/net/netfilter/nf_conntrack_queue.h diff --git a/include/net/netfilter/nf_conntrack_queue.h b/include/net/netfilter/nf_conntrack_queue.h new file mode 100644 index 0000000..417820f --- /dev/null +++ b/include/net/netfilter/nf_conntrack_queue.h @@ -0,0 +1,17 @@ +#ifndef _NF_CONNTRACK_QUEUE_H +#define _NF_CONNTRACK_QUEUE_H + + +#if defined(CONFIG_NF_QUEUE_CONNBYTES_BYPASS) +#include + +struct nf_conntrack_queue { + spinlock_t lock; + union { + u32 connbytes; + u32 tcp_seq; /* TCP sequence number */ + } dir[IP_CT_DIR_MAX]; +}; + +#endif +#endif /* _NF_CONNTRACK_QUEUE_H */ -- 1.7.1